Jayalalithaa requests Gogoi for rhino pair

Tamil Nadu Chief Minister J. Jayalalithaa requested her Assam counterpart Tarun Gogoi to spare a pair of the greater one-horned rhinoceros in exchange for a pair of Indian gaur.

In a letter to Gogoi, the text of which was released to the media here Wednesday, Jayalalithaa said the Arignar Anna Zoological Park near here has a collection of 1,400 individual animals consisting of 143 species but no rhinoceros.

"The greater one-horned rhinoceros was in our collection from 1985 to 1989. The animal died in 1989 and after that there has been no representative of this magnificent animal in our zoo," she said.

According to her, it will be fitting for the zoo to have the Indian rhinoceros considering the number of visitors and the popularity of the animal.

"We have sufficient numbers of Indian gaur, which we can give in exchange to the government of Assam. The Indian gaur is one of our flagship species," she said.
